A care provider in Boroughbridge is looking for a dedicated individual to support a young lady with learning disabilities in her home. The role involves providing personal care and support during two waking nights a week.

Candidates should have experience in this field and must be female due to the nature of the care required.

The position offers a competitive pay rate of £16.63 per hour and pro-rated holiday.
